About Linren Zhou
Linren Zhou is a scholar working on Civil and Structural Engineering, Pollution, Building and Construction, Mechanical Engineering and Environmental Engineering, having authored 23 papers that have together received 435 indexed citations. Recurring topics across this work include Structural Health Monitoring Techniques (19 papers), Structural Engineering and Vibration Analysis (12 papers), Concrete Corrosion and Durability (11 papers), Smart Materials for Construction (8 papers), Infrastructure Maintenance and Monitoring (5 papers), Railway Engineering and Dynamics (2 papers), Innovations in Concrete and Construction Materials (2 papers) and Recycling and utilization of industrial and municipal waste in materials production (2 papers). The work is most often cited by research in Civil and Structural Engineering (360 citations), Pollution (64 citations), Statistics, Probability and Uncertainty (29 citations), Mechanics of Materials (53 citations) and Mechanical Engineering (78 citations). Linren Zhou has collaborated with scholars based in China, Hong Kong and United Kingdom. Frequent co-authors include Yong Xia, Jinping Ou, Guirong Yan, Ki Young Koo, James Brownjohn, Lan Chen, Lei Wang, Lei Wang, Xiaoqing Zhou and Bo Chen. Their work appears in journals such as Advances in Structural Engineering, Buildings, Engineering Structures, Computer-Aided Civil and Infrastructure Engineering and Journal of Bridge Engineering.
